Is Tretinoin Gel or Cream Better for Your Skin?

Neither tretinoin gel nor cream is universally better. The right choice depends on your skin type, how sensitive your skin is, and what you’re treating. Gel formulations work best for oily or acne-prone skin, while creams suit dry or sensitive skin. But the differences go deeper than that, and newer formulations blur the line between the two.

How the Two Formulations Differ

Tretinoin cream is a blend of water and oil, which makes it more moisturizing and leaves a slight residue on the skin. Tretinoin gel traditionally contains alcohol, which makes it lightweight and fast-absorbing but also more drying. Despite these vehicle differences, both deliver the same active ingredient to your skin. FDA bioequivalence data shows no statistical differences in plasma levels of tretinoin between gel and cream at the same concentration, meaning your body absorbs similar amounts of the drug regardless of vehicle.

The real differences show up in how your skin reacts to the inactive ingredients surrounding the tretinoin, not the tretinoin itself.

Which Works Better for Oily or Acne-Prone Skin

Gel is generally the better pick if your skin runs oily or you’re prone to breakouts. The lighter texture absorbs quickly without adding oil to skin that already produces plenty of it. Cream formulations contain emollients that can clog pores in some people, potentially worsening acne. If you notice new breakouts after starting tretinoin cream, the vehicle’s oil content may be contributing.

Gel also layers well under other products without pilling or leaving a greasy film, which matters if you apply sunscreen or makeup in the morning after a nighttime tretinoin routine.

Which Works Better for Dry or Sensitive Skin

Cream is typically the safer choice for dry, sensitive, or eczema-prone skin. The oil-and-water base provides some built-in moisture, which partially offsets the drying and peeling that tretinoin causes during the adjustment period. Standard gels, with their alcohol content, can strip moisture from skin that’s already struggling to retain it.

In studies comparing tolerability, cream-treated skin showed more erythema, scaling, and dryness than newer lotion formulations, but traditional alcohol-based gels can be even more drying for people who start with a compromised skin barrier. If your skin feels tight or flaky even before starting tretinoin, cream gives you a gentler starting point.

Microsphere Gel: A Third Option

Not all tretinoin gels are the same. Microsphere gel (sold as Retin-A Micro) uses a completely different delivery system. Tiny porous polymer spheres sit on the skin’s surface and slowly release tretinoin over time, rather than depositing it all at once. This controlled release is designed to reduce irritation.

In a half-face comparison trial on women with sensitive skin, microsphere gel at 0.1% was statistically less irritating than tretinoin cream at the same concentration. A separate 21-day irritation study on people with normal skin confirmed the same pattern. This matters because microsphere gel can deliver a higher concentration of tretinoin with less irritation than you’d expect from that strength.

There are tradeoffs, though. The microspheres give the gel a gritty texture that some people find unpleasant to apply. And while the slow-release system delays the onset of irritation, it doesn’t necessarily reduce the total cumulative irritation over time. Some users also experience a “burst effect,” where tretinoin sitting near the outer walls of the microspheres releases all at once, causing a wave of dryness, peeling, or redness.

Available Strengths Aren’t Identical

Your choice may partly come down to what concentrations are available. Tretinoin cream comes in 0.025%, 0.05%, and 0.1% strengths. Standard gel comes in 0.01%, 0.025%, and 0.05%. If you need the highest concentration (0.1%) in a gel, you’ll be looking at the microsphere formulation specifically.

For people just starting tretinoin, most prescribers begin at a lower concentration regardless of vehicle. The 0.025% strength is available in both cream and gel, giving you the most flexibility to choose based on skin type.

Side Effects by Formulation

All tretinoin causes some degree of dryness, peeling, and redness during the first several weeks. The vehicle changes how quickly and how intensely those side effects hit.

In one comparison of micronized tretinoin gel 0.05% versus microsphere gel 0.1%, the lower-strength micronized gel produced noticeably fewer side effects: 14% of users reported dry skin versus 32% with microsphere gel, 5% experienced redness versus 23%, and 5% had peeling versus 23%. The concentration difference accounts for much of this gap, but it illustrates how choosing a gentler formulation at a lower strength can make the adjustment period far more manageable.

Standard alcohol-based gels tend to cause the most drying and stinging on application, especially in the first few weeks. Creams cause less immediate stinging but can contribute to a heavy, occlusive feeling. Microsphere gels fall somewhere in between, with delayed irritation onset but similar total irritation over time.

How to Choose

Your skin type is the strongest deciding factor:

  • Oily or acne-prone skin: Standard gel or microsphere gel. The lightweight base won’t add oil or clog pores.
  • Dry or mature skin: Cream. The built-in moisture helps offset tretinoin’s drying effects, and you avoid the alcohol found in standard gels.
  • Sensitive skin prone to irritation: Microsphere gel or cream at a low concentration. Microsphere gel’s slow-release mechanism delays irritation, though the gritty texture isn’t for everyone.
  • Combination skin: Either can work. Some people apply gel to their oilier T-zone and cream to drier cheeks, though this requires two prescriptions.

If you’ve tried one formulation and found the side effects intolerable, switching vehicles before giving up on tretinoin entirely is worth considering. The same concentration in a different base can feel like a completely different product on your skin.
